Decorative Stitch Themes …linework, little motifs, stitch-mates & libraries
for BERNINA B 590, B 790 PRO & B 990 machine owners
Follow steps building and saving intriguing linework themes, one seasonal and one abstract. Steps, plus guidelines, aid in creating a third theme all your own. Test stitch all. How long are various repeats? Try two easy methods to end up your desired length. Next, we super-size the decorative stitch impact with the help of a few chalk lines. Afterward, playfully create little motifs with repeats. Diagrams make it easy. Your choice …a whimsical butterfly, imaginary flower, raindrops and/or grasses. All are very forgiving. The wind could be blowing, right? A little organizer bag is easily sewn and showcases linework and mini motifs. Then we look at and consider decorative stitch libraries. Paula demos how she most often uses using her library. Pointing out advantages unique to different methods, find out where to access free online resources for your library. Get your Sideways Motion Mojo on ...and quilt with these too
for BERNINA B 790 PRO & B 990 machine owners
Achieve fantastic BERNINA stitch quality, plus creativity, using sideways motion and editing. You’ll have guided practice for both continuous line and closed motifs. Balance (aka optimizing) removes unwanted separations and overlaps. Follow steps, test sew and we’ll fine tune settings for particular materials and save. You’ll get the hang of adjusting balance, optimizing for different materials. Other editing options make it fun. From the edited/saved stitches decorate: a ribbon, a single cloth layer and quilt something too. It’s really quite pretty quilted. With your stitched pincushion ingredients, follow simple assembly steps. If you finish early, freely explore any alternate stitch pattern(s) you’re attracted to. We’ll begin to brainstorm project ideas especially ideal for sideways motion stitching. Paula shows special effect samples for inspiration. Maybe abracadabra the pincushion idea into a pillow? Wow to the JUMBO JUMBO ...useful in so many ways
for BERNINA B 990 machine owners
Whether you seek bold stitch drama or delicate details, welcome to a hands-on tour of B 990 Jumbo. On the sewing side, jumbo is layered with other edits for beautiful effects. Ideal thread weight varies, not by percentage, but in a surprising way. Create and test-stitch combi-jumbo too. Save favorites in a fresh folder. On a whim, open one in embroidery. A few onscreen clicks and embroider half your zipper bag. A big bold element pairs with something quite tiny, options provided, for the remainder. Intermission! In BERNINA Designer Software, Paula shows additional methods to creatively refine jumbo stitches. Assemble a lined zipper bag using a great little technique to reduce zipper bulk. A Bird's Eye View ...sewing & embroidery improv with camera
for BERNINA B 990 machine owners
Structure and whimsy unite! Take the essential steps to most effectively and broadly use your BERNINA 990 camera. You’ll spend most of the class having camera fun with stitch patterns in sewing mode. A quick embroidery module stitch-out of an outline shape provides the start. Out-of-the-hoop decorative stitch "coloring" ensues. Learn to gauge start points, practice selecting and editing stitch patterns to best fit various shapes. Change thread color whenever you feel like it. This is a very relaxing process. Results entertain, sometimes surprise and are naturally appealing. And as you learn, make an oopsie work. There are tips for this! We'll also take a look at how the scanner can save the day, expanding your creativity. At end of class, share a glimpse of your stitching on webcam to celebrate everyone's Bird's Eye View.
